What Makes a Great Security Camera

High Resolution (1080p+)

2K or 4K captures facial features and license plates at a distance. 1080p is the minimum for useful footage in most scenarios.

Quality Night Vision

Color night vision or strong IR illumination is essential—most security incidents happen after dark. The best cameras maintain detail even in low light.

Smart Detection

AI that distinguishes people, packages, vehicles, and animals dramatically reduces false alerts, so you only get notified when it matters.

Key Takeaway

Consider total cost of ownership over 3 years. A $200 camera with a $10/month subscription costs $560 total, while the Eufy S330 at $300 has zero ongoing costs.

Do security cameras need a subscription?
Not always. The Eufy Security Cam S330 offers full functionality with local storage and zero monthly fees. Others like Arlo, Ring, and Nest offer free basic features with optional paid plans for extended history.
Are wireless security cameras reliable?
Yes, modern wireless cameras like the Arlo Pro 5S and Nest Cam (Battery) are highly reliable with 6+ month battery life, weather resistance, and stable WiFi connectivity. Wired cameras offer more consistent power but less flexible placement.
What resolution do I need for a security camera?
1080p is the minimum for useful footage. 2K captures facial features at distance, and 4K (like the Eufy S330) provides the most detail. Higher resolution uses more storage and bandwidth.
